Tunable, high-repetition-rate, harmonically mode-locked ytterbium fiber laser
Nick G Usechak1, Govind P Agrawal, Jonathan D Zuegel
1The Institute of Optics, University of Rochester, Rochester, New York 14627, USA. noodles@optics.rochester.edu
Optics Letters
|July 6, 2004
Abstract:
We report a ytterbium fiber laser mode locked at its 281st harmonic, which corresponds to a repetition rate greater than 10 GHz. The laser produces linearly polarized, 2-ps pulses with up to 38-mW of average output power. The mode-locked pulses are tunable over a 58-nm window centered on 1053 nm.
